#asktheexpert how should I keep my toddler’s teeth healthy? She has cavity on her front upper teeth. She is 3, I brush her teeth every morning & have stopped giving milk before she brushes, also she does gargle after every meal & drinks.

1 Answer
ExpertDr. Garima VermaDentist4 years ago
A. hello mam for cavity you need to visit a dentist as once cavity is formed there is nothing you can do at home. start brushing the teeth of your kid 2 times a day and you should brush your kids teeth yourself. do not give any sweet milk while sleeping or before sleeping
